Why Does Brace Type Matter for Different Rotator Cuff Injuries?

Let’s talk about what is actually going on inside your shoulder.
Rotator cuff tears are not rare. In fact, research shows that about 1 in 5 people in the general population has some degree of rotator cuff tearing, and that number increases with age. Many people walk around with small tears and do not even realize it. Others feel it immediately when strength drops or pain starts waking them up at night.
Your rotator cuff is made up of four small but powerful muscles that keep the ball of your shoulder centered in the socket while you lift, rotate, punch, throw, or press. When one of those tendons becomes irritated or torn, the shoulder loses stability. That is when you start to notice weakness, clicking, or a sharp pain at certain angles.
For moderate-to-large tears, orthopedic surgeons perform arthroscopic repair to physically reattach the tendon to the bone, thereby restoring long-term joint stability.
Here is what matters most. A mild strain, a partial tear, and a full-thickness tear are completely different situations. And the way you protect your shoulder should reflect that reality.
How Do Shoulder Braces Mechanically Improve Rotator Cuff Recovery?

A shoulder brace is not a shortcut to healing. It is a tool to control stress on injured tissue, so your shoulder has a real chance to recover.
When the rotator cuff is irritated or healing, even small uncontrolled movements can keep reloading the tendon. The right brace limits excessive motion, improves joint awareness, and reduces strain during vulnerable phases.
Let’s break down what that means in practice.
1. Pain Reduction Through Load Control
By restricting erratic glenohumeral translation, properly fitted braces reduce mechanical load on the inflamed tendons, which immediately diminishes acute pain signals.
A randomized controlled trial published in the American Journal of Sports Medicine found that patients using a rotator cuff brace experienced about a 40 percent reduction in pain within two weeks, compared to roughly 20 percent in those who did not use a brace.
That early reduction matters. Less pain usually means better sleep, better rehab participation, and less joint guarding.
For post-surgical cases, immobilization plays an even bigger role. Research cited in the Journal of Rehabilitation Research reported more than a 60 percent reduction in postoperative pain among patients undergoing rotator cuff repair using a proper sling immobilizer.
In early healing, stability is not optional. It is protective.
2. Supporting Safe Return to Activity
For athletes and active individuals, the goal is rarely a complete shutdown. It is a controlled return.
The same study above, published in the Journal of Orthopaedics and Sports Rehabilitation, showed that patients using sports-grade shoulder supports reported up to a 70% reduction in pain. About half returned to roughly 50 percent of normal activity levels within eight weeks, and 81 percent reported substantial benefit.
That tells us something important. When the brace matches the injury stage, people can stay active without constantly aggravating the shoulder.
3. Position Matters More Than Most People Realize
Not all support positions are equal.
A randomized study comparing external rotation braces to standard internal rotation slings found lower recurrence rates and better early pain scores in the external rotation group. How the shoulder is positioned directly influences the stress and stability of healing.
In other words, it is not just about wearing a brace. It is about wearing the right type, in the right position, at the right time.

Severe or Post-Surgical Rotator Cuff Tears
Goal: Maximum protection and controlled immobilization
If you have had surgical repair of a moderate-to-large tear or you are dealing with a confirmed full-thickness tear, this is not the time for a lightweight compression sleeve.
This phase is about protection.
Why Immobilization Matters
After a tendon is surgically repaired, it needs time to biologically reattach and strengthen. Excess movement places tension on the repair site. That tension increases retear risk.
A prospective study published in JBJS Open Access found that patients with less than 60 percent brace-wearing compliance had a 13-fold higher risk of retear. Retear rates were 3 percent in high-compliance patients versus 27 percent in low-compliance patients.
That is not a small difference. That is the difference between healing and starting over.
Angle and Positioning Matter
A 2025 randomized controlled trial comparing 30° versus 45° abduction braces found that 45° positioning produced better early passive range of motion and lower retear rates in moderate-to-severe repair tension cases.
However, long-term functional scores equalized by 24 months. This tells us something important. Early protection influences the quality of short-term healing, even if long-term function may converge.
At the same time, a 2023 systematic review found that abduction braces did not significantly improve long-term functional scores compared with simple slings in any case. This reinforces that immobilization prescriptions should be individualized based on tear size and repair tension, not applied blindly.
As cited in recent clinical literature, immobilization should be matched to the specific repair conditions to reduce stress at the repair site.

Moderate Tears in Rehabilitation
Goal: Controlled stability while gradually restoring movement
Once early healing has progressed and your provider clears you to transition out of strict immobilization, the focus shifts.
Now we are balancing protection with progressive loading.
What Stabilizing Braces Do
Stabilizing shoulder braces use strap systems to limit excessive abduction or external rotation while allowing controlled functional movement. They are often used during mid-stage rehab when strengthening begins.
This does not mean the brace heals the tendon. It means the brace reduces stress enough to allow structured rehab to work more effectively.
Positioning Still Matters
A randomized study comparing external rotation braces to internal rotation slings found lower recurrence rates and improved early pain scores in the external rotation group. Again, positioning influences mechanical stress.
What This Means for You
If you are:
-
Recovering from a partial tear
-
Transitioning out of post-op immobilization
-
Returning to controlled strength work
A stabilizing brace may provide the balance between support and movement you need.
But this phase should be guided by a clinician. The brace is a tool within a rehab plan, not a standalone solution.

Impingement and Posture-Related Pain
Goal: Improve mechanics, not restrict motion
Sometimes the rotator cuff is not torn. It is overloaded because the shoulder blade is not moving well.
Rounded shoulders, poor scapular control, and overhead overuse can narrow the subacromial space and irritate the tendons.
In these cases, posture-correcting or scapular-guiding braces can help provide external feedback and gentle positioning support.
They are most effective when combined with the strengthening of:
-
Mid and lower trapezius
-
Serratus anterior
-
Rotator cuff stabilizers
These braces should gradually become unnecessary as strength improves.
They guide. They do not replace muscular control.

Safe Use and Wear Guidelines

This is where recovery either stays on track or quietly drifts backward.
A shoulder brace can protect healing tissue and reduce pain. But if it is worn too aggressively, for too long, or without a progression plan, it can slow healing just as easily as it can support it.
The goal is not maximum restriction. The goal is the right amount of protection at the right time.
Let’s go deeper.
1. Follow the Phase, Not Your Fear
In the early postoperative period, immobilization is not optional. The repaired tendon needs protection as it begins to reattach to bone. During this phase, strict wear schedules are often prescribed for a reason.
But here is where problems start.
Once pain improves, some people remove the brace too early and overload the repair. Others do the opposite. They keep the shoulder immobilized far longer than necessary because movement feels scary.
Research shows that prolonged unloading can trigger catabolic changes in tendon and muscle tissue. In simple terms, when tissues are not exposed to appropriate stress, they begin to weaken. Muscle fibers shrink. Tendon quality declines. Neuromuscular coordination fades.
Your shoulder needs protection early. It also needs progressive stimulation later.
Let your recovery stage guide your brace use, not your anxiety.
2. Understand the Real Risks of Over-Immobilization
Over-immobilization is not harmless.
When the shoulder joint is kept restricted for extended periods without gradual reintroduction of motion, several risks increase:
-
Muscle atrophy in the rotator cuff and surrounding stabilizers
-
Loss of passive and active range of motion
-
Joint capsule tightening
-
Reduced proprioception and coordination
-
Increased likelihood of adhesive capsulitis, commonly called frozen shoulder
Frozen shoulder deserves special attention.
It occurs when the joint capsule thickens and stiffens, severely limiting motion. It can develop after injury or surgery, particularly when movement is avoided for too long. In some cases, frozen shoulder becomes more functionally limiting than the original tendon injury.
Immobilization protects healing tissue. But excessive immobilization can create a new problem.
That is why timing matters.
3. Wear Time Should Be Strategic
Brace wear should have a purpose.
Here is how that typically looks:
Early Post-Surgical Phase
-
Near-continuous wear as directed by your surgeon
-
Removal only for hygiene and prescribed exercises
-
Primary goal: protect the repair site
Mid-Stage Rehabilitation
-
Brace used during vulnerable activities
-
Gradual increase in supervised movement
-
Primary goal: controlled reintroduction of load
Return-to-Activity Phase
-
Brace worn during higher-risk movements or sport
-
Removed during safe strengthening and mobility sessions
-
Primary goal: support performance without dependency
If you find yourself wearing a brace 24 hours a day, months after surgery, without clear medical direction, it is time to reassess.
Braces are transitional tools. They are not meant to become permanent armor.
4. Monitor Circulation, Nerves, and Skin
A properly fitted brace should feel secure but never restrictive to the point of harm.
Check daily for:
-
Persistent redness that lasts more than 20 to 30 minutes after removal
-
Blisters or pressure sores
-
Tingling or numbness in the arm or hand
-
Swelling in the fingers
-
Pale or bluish discoloration of the hand
-
Increased stiffness that does not ease with gentle movement
These signs can indicate excessive compression, nerve irritation, or compromised circulation.
If something feels wrong, adjust immediately. If symptoms persist, consult your healthcare provider.
Your brace should support your shoulder. It should not compromise the rest of your arm.

When to See a Healthcare Professional

We believe in smart self-management. But there are moments when guessing is not enough.
A shoulder brace can support recovery. It cannot diagnose a tear, repair a tendon, or rule out a more serious condition.
If you are unsure what level of injury you are dealing with, getting clarity early can prevent months of frustration.
Seek Immediate Medical Evaluation If You Notice:
-
A sudden tearing or popping sensation followed by sharp pain
-
Inability to lift your arm at all
-
Visible deformity around the shoulder
-
Rapid swelling or significant bruising
-
Numbness, weakness, or loss of grip strength
-
Fever, redness, or warmth around the joint
These signs may indicate a full-thickness tear, dislocation, fracture, or another condition that requires urgent assessment.
Schedule an Evaluation If:
-
Night pain consistently wakes you up
-
Pain has lasted more than a few weeks despite rest and support
-
Strength continues to decline
-
Your shoulder feels unstable or like it may “give out.”
-
The range of motion is progressively shrinking
-
The brace causes new symptoms or discomfort
Persistent night pain, in particular, is often associated with more significant rotator cuff pathology and deserves professional evaluation.
Why Professional Input Matters
An orthopedic specialist or sports medicine provider can:
-
Perform a physical exam to assess tendon integrity
-
Order imaging if needed
-
Determine whether you are dealing with inflammation, partial tearing, or full rupture
-
Guide immobilization timing and progression
-
Refer you to physical therapy with a structured plan
The right diagnosis shapes the right protection strategy.

Which side should I sleep on with a rotator cuff injury and brace?
You should sleep on your non-injured side or on your back with the injured shoulder supported by pillows. Avoid lying directly on the affected area because added pressure can increase discomfort and delay recovery. Some people find sleeping in a recliner chair more comfortable during early recovery because it reduces strain and supports restricted movement. Cold therapy before bed may help manage pain and reduce swelling. If shoulder pain continues to disrupt sleep, consult your healthcare professional for adjustments to your plan.
Can a shoulder brace fix a torn rotator cuff without surgery?
No, a shoulder brace cannot repair a full-thickness tear on its own. It can provide superior support, reduce strain, improve blood flow, and help reduce pain, but it does not reattach torn tissue to bone. For partial tears, physical therapy and proper shoulder support can promote healing and provide temporary relief during activity. In cases of a severe tear, surgical repair may be necessary to restore function and prevent further injury. A brace is a supportive tool in the healing journey, not a replacement for medical care.
